基于CAN总线步进电机控制系统的设计

摘    要:研究了CAN总线的驱动和报文收发过程,设计了一套基于CAN总线的嵌入式步进电机控制系统。该系统使用MCP2510 CAN总线驱动器和TJA1050 CAN总线收发器,由S3C2410嵌入式处理器通过CAN总线发送控制信号,AT89S51单片机通过CAN总线接收控制信号并驱动步进电机,实现步进电机的启动、停止、正转、反转等动作。

Design of Step Motor Control System Based on CAN Bus

Abstract:Researched CAN bus driven and message sending-receiving process,an embedded step motor control system based on CAN bus has been designed.The system uses MCP2510 CAN bus driver and TJA1050 CAN bus transceiver,S3C2410 embedded processor sends control signals through CAN bus,AT89S51 microcontroller receives control signals through CAN bus and drive a step motor,achieve step motor to start,stop,forward and reverse action.
